Three Cd(II) and Zn(II) Coordination Polymers Based on 2-(4'-Carboxyphenyl)-1H-imidazole-4,5-dicarboxylic Acid: Syntheses, Topological Structures, Fluorescent Spectra and DNA Binding |

Abstract: Three coordination polymers of cadmium and zinc {[Cd2(CPhIDC)(bimb)]·H2O}n (1), {[Cd2(CPhIDC)(phen)2]·3H2O}n (2), {[Zn2(CPhIDC)(bpp)]·1.5H2O}n (3), (H4CPhIDC=2-(4'-carboxyphenyl)-1H-imidazole-4,5-dicar-boxylic acid, bimb=1,4-bis(imidazol-1-yl)butane, phen=1,10-phenanthroline, bpp=1,3-di(pyridin-4-yl)propane) have been synthesized by solvothermal reaction and characterized by IR, EA and PXRD. Single crystal X-ray diffraction shows that the H4CPhIDC ligand presents fully deprotonated motifs of CPhIDC4- in three corresponding polymers. Moreover, the fully deprotonated ligands coordinate in the μ4 and μ5 manner to generate 2D and 3D polymers, displaying three different coordination modes. Complexes 1 and 3 exhibit 3D structures with (3,4,5)-connected frameworks with (5·6·7)(4·52·6·72)(4·52·6·74·82) topology, but the metal ions and auxiliary ligands are different. 2 displays a 2D wave-like fishing nets structure with 44·62 topology. The fluorescence spectra in the solid state and DNA binding properties of the polymers and ligand are investigated. |
